Prologis, Inc. (PLD) Income Tax Expense
The tax expense for Prologis, Inc. (PLD) is $204.02 Million with a year-over-year change of +22.21%. Income tax expense is the amount a company pays in federal, state, and foreign income taxes based on its taxable income for the period.

Annual Tax Expense History
| Year | Tax Expense | YoY Change | % Change |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| $204.02M | +$37.07M | +22.21% |
| 2024 | $166.94M | $-44.09M | -20.89% |
| 2023 | $211.04M | +$75.63M | +55.85% |
| 2022 | $135.41M | $-38.85M | -22.29% |
| 2021 | $174.26M | +$43.80M | +33.57% |
| 2020 | $130.46M | +$55.94M | +75.07% |
| 2019 | $74.52M | +$11.19M | +17.66% |
| 2018 | $63.33M | +$8.72M | +15.97% |
| 2017 | $54.61M | +$45,000 | +0.08% |
| 2016 | $54.56M | +$31.47M | +136.31% |
| 2015 | $23.09M | +$48.75M | +190.00% |
| 2014 | $-25.66M | $-132.39M | -124.04% |
| 2013 | $106.73M | +$103.15M | +2881.37% |
| 2012 | $3.58M | +$1.80M | +101.58% |
| 2011 | $1.78M | +$32.27M | +105.82% |

About Prologis, Inc.
Prologis, Inc. is the undisputed global leader in logistics real estate, strategically focusing its operations on high-barrier, high-growth markets. As of December 31, 2020, the company's extensive portfolio spanned approximately 984 million square feet (91 million square meters) of both existing properties and planned development projects, located across 19 countries. This significant footprint is managed through a blend of wholly-owned assets and co-investment ventures. Prologis leases its contemporary logistics facilities to a diverse client base of roughly 5,500 customers, primarily serving business-to-business (B2B) and retail/online fulfillment needs.
